🎓 Eligibility Criteria for Bank of Baroda LBO Recruitment 2025
The Bank of Baroda has outlined specific eligibility criteria to ensure that candidates are well-suited for the Local Bank Officer role. Below are the detailed requirements:
✅ Educational Qualification
- Candidates must hold a Graduate degree in any discipline from a recognized university or institute approved by the UGC or equivalent.
- The Bank of Baroda emphasizes academic excellence and encourages graduates from diverse fields to apply, provided they meet other criteria.
✅ Work Experience
- A minimum of 1 year of experience in a Scheduled Commercial Bank or Regional Rural Bank (RRB) is mandatory.
- Experience with Non-Banking Financial Companies (NBFCs), cooperatives, or fintech companies is not acceptable for this role.
- The Bank of Baroda values practical banking experience, as it equips candidates to handle the responsibilities of an LBO effectively.
✅ Age Limit (as on 01.07.2025)
- Minimum Age: 21 years
- Maximum Age: 30 years
- Age relaxation is applicable as per government norms for reserved categories (SC/ST/OBC/PwBD/ESM), in line with the Bank of Baroda’s commitment to inclusivity.
✅ Language Proficiency
- Candidates must be proficient in reading, writing, and speaking the local language of the state they are applying for.
- The Bank of Baroda places significant emphasis on language skills to ensure LBOs can connect with customers and communities effectively.

🧪 Selection Process for Bank of Baroda LBO Recruitment 2025
The Bank of Baroda has designed a multi-stage selection process to ensure that only the most capable candidates are selected for the Local Bank Officer role. The stages are:
- Online Test: A computer-based examination to assess candidates’ aptitude, banking knowledge, and general awareness.
- Local Language Test (LPT): A test to verify proficiency in the local language of the applied state.
- Psychometric Test: An assessment to evaluate candidates’ behavioral and personality traits, ensuring alignment with the Bank of Baroda’s values.
- Group Discussion / Personal Interview: A final stage to assess communication skills, problem-solving abilities, and suitability for the LBO role.
🖥 Online Test Structure
The online test is a critical component of the Bank of Baroda LBO Recruitment 2025 selection process. The structure is as follows:
Subject | Questions | Marks |
---|---|---|
Reasoning and Quantitative Aptitude | 30 | 30 |
General & Economic Awareness | 30 | 30 |
English Language | 30 | 30 |
Banking Knowledge | 30 | 30 |
Total | 120 | 120 |
- Duration: 2 hours
- Negative Marking: ¼ mark deducted for each incorrect answer
- Mode: Computer-based, conducted at designated centers across India
The Bank of Baroda ensures that the online test is rigorous yet fair, testing candidates’ ability to handle real-world banking scenarios while maintaining a focus on analytical and communication skills.
💰 Salary and Benefits for Bank of Baroda Local Bank Officers
The Bank of Baroda offers an attractive compensation package for Local Bank Officers, reflecting its commitment to rewarding talent and fostering career growth. The salary details are:
- Basic Pay: ₹48,480/–
- Gross Emoluments: ₹80,000 – ₹85,920 per month (inclusive of House Rent Allowance, Dearness Allowance, and other perks)
- Additional Benefits:
- Performance-linked incentives
- Comprehensive health and life insurance
- Retirement benefits, including provident fund and gratuity
- Opportunities for career progression within the Bank of Baroda

📌 Roles and Responsibilities of a Bank of Baroda Local Bank Officer
The Local Bank Officer role at the Bank of Baroda is a dynamic and impactful position that focuses on strengthening the bank’s presence at the grassroots level. Key responsibilities include:
- Customer Relationship Management: Building and maintaining strong relationships with customers to enhance trust and loyalty.
- Business Development: Achieving targets for Current Account and Savings Account (CASA), loans, and digital banking products.
- Community Engagement: Leveraging local language and cultural knowledge to connect with communities and promote the Bank of Baroda’s services.
- Credit Support: Facilitating credit access for individuals and small businesses, contributing to local economic growth.
- Operational Excellence: Ensuring smooth branch operations and compliance with the Bank of Baroda’s policies and procedures.
